Deftones wrap up two weeks of writing

In February, Deftones vocalist Chino Moreno told Rolling Stone that the band would be taking the year off. A few weeks later, in an interview with Soundwave TV, he said the rest of the band was already writing new material.

But now the band has recently posted a photo (below) to Facebook, with the caption, “Wrapping up 2 weeks of writing.”

The latest Deftones studio album, Koi No Yokan, came out in November of 2012, so it looks like a three year gap with a 2015 release is a possibility. The band will be headlining the Sunset Stage at the first-ever U.S. edition of Rock In Rio, in Las Vegas, NV on May 8th-9th and May 15th-16th, 2015.
